Civilian employment adjusted to NFP concept is diving (after retroactive application of 2026 population controls to January 2026 data), as are real retail sales in January. Figure 1: Implied Nonfarm Payroll early benchmark (NFP) (blue), civilian employment adjusted to NFP concept, using smoothed population controls (bold orange), manufacturing production (red), private NFP from ADP (light […]
